With Drive-Away Dolls, Ethan Coen goes solo, parting company for the first time with his sidekick brother, Joel, to direct a feature-length fiction film. Expected in cinemas on April 3, 2024, Drive-Away Dolls is a zany, light-hearted queer road movie .
1999. Jamie(Margaret Qualley) and her friend Marian(Geraldine Viswanathan) set out to transport a car from Philadelphia to Tallahassee. After an imbroglio concerning the vehicle, worthy of Le Corniaud (only here, no Youkounkoun hidden in the horn, but a suitcase with rather... unusual contents, hidden in the trunk), things turn sour. They're being chased by a gang of criminals who aren't very bright.
If the two lesbian heroines are particularly endearing, Jamie with her thick Texas accent and Marian on a quest for pleasure, the rest of the cast is just as polished, especially Jonah Hill's sister Beanie Feldstein as a spurned ex who doesn't see it that way.
As funny in content as it is creative in form, this unconventional road trip exudes the Coen attitude, even if there's only one behind the camera: neon colors, distorting counterplanes, rapid zooms and dezooms, pop transitions, cartoonish sound effects, galloping dialogue, all interspersed with psychedelic sequences set to Funkadelic, with an extra cameo from Miley Cyrus as a young hippie who's good with her hands.
And let's not forget the nods to Tarantino: a low-angle shot from the trunk of the car and the discovery of the contents of the suitcase - invisible, for a moment, to the viewer - at a diner, as in Pulp Fiction. A queer comedy that doesn't take itself too seriously. It's good fun!
